Where Flat Roofing Is Used on Homes
Flat roofing appears throughout residential properties, often in more places than homeowners realise.
Garages
The most common residential flat roof application. Whether attached or detached, integral or standalone, most garages feature flat roofs. These roofs protect vehicles, stored items, and—in the case of attached garages—prevent water ingress affecting the main house.
Typical sizes: 15–55m² depending on single, double, or larger configurations.
Extensions
Single-storey extensions almost universally feature flat roofing. Rear extensions, side returns, kitchen extensions, and wraparound additions all typically employ flat or very low-pitched coverings.
Why flat roofs dominate: They keep overall height manageable, integrate well with existing structures, often fall within permitted development allowances, and maximise usable internal space.
Typical sizes: 10–50m² for most domestic extensions.
Porches
Front and rear porches provide weather protection and transition spaces. Most feature flat roofs, though some incorporate slight pitches for drainage.
Typical sizes: 2–8m² for standard residential porches.
Bay Windows
Victorian, Edwardian, and some modern properties feature bay windows with flat or very low-pitched roofs. These often become problem areas when original lead or felt coverings fail.
Typical sizes: 2–5m² per bay.
Dormers
Loft conversions frequently add dormer windows, creating flat roof sections within or alongside the main pitched roof. Dormer roofs face particular exposure at roof level.
Typical sizes: 3–10m² depending on dormer style.
Outbuildings
Sheds, workshops, garden rooms, home offices, and other outbuildings commonly feature flat roofs. As these structures become more sophisticated (particularly garden offices and studios), roofing quality expectations have increased.
Typical sizes: Highly variable, from small sheds (4m²) to substantial garden buildings (30m²+).
Balconies and Walkways
Some homes feature flat roof areas used as balconies or providing access between sections. These require robust, traffic-resistant coverings.
Utility Areas
Boot rooms, utility rooms, WC additions, and similar small extensions often feature flat roofs.
Understanding Flat Roof Materials
Material choice significantly affects performance, lifespan, and value. Here’s what’s available for residential properties.
EPDM Rubber Roofing
The modern standard for quality residential flat roofing.
What it is: EPDM (ethylene propylene diene monomer) is a synthetic rubber membrane. It comes in large sheets that bond to the roof deck, creating a seamless waterproof covering.
Lifespan: 30–50 years with proper installation and minimal maintenance.
Strengths:
- Exceptional longevity
- Excellent waterproofing
- Handles temperature extremes without cracking
- UV resistant without additional coatings
- Minimal maintenance requirements
- Proven track record (60+ years globally)
Considerations:
- Higher upfront cost than felt
- Requires proper installation technique
- Standard colour is black
Best for: Virtually all residential flat roof applications where quality and longevity matter.
Felt Roofing
The traditional flat roof material, still available but increasingly superseded.
What it is: Layers of bitumen-coated material, typically applied with torch-on methods or as self-adhesive sheets.
Lifespan: 10–15 years typically, though this varies significantly with quality and conditions.
Strengths:
- Lowest upfront cost
- Familiar to most roofers
- Widely available
Weaknesses:
- Shorter lifespan requiring more frequent replacement
- Degrades in wet conditions over time
- Multiple seams create potential failure points
- Maintenance needs increase with age
Best for: Budget-constrained situations or temporary structures. Not recommended for quality home improvements.
Fibreglass (GRP)
An alternative to EPDM offering different characteristics.
What it is: Glass-reinforced polyester applied as layers of matting and liquid resin that cure to form a rigid shell.
Lifespan: 20–25 years typically.
Strengths:
- Seamless finish
- Good durability
- Colour options available
- Hard-wearing surface
Weaknesses:
- Can crack if building moves or settles
- Temperature-sensitive installation
- Less flexible than EPDM
- Strong odour during application
Best for: Stable structures where colour matching is important or hard surface is beneficial.
Other Options
TPO and PVC membranes: Alternative single-ply options occasionally used residentially, more common commercially.
Liquid applied systems: Painted-on coatings that cure to form membranes. Useful for complex shapes or overlay applications.
Lead: Traditional material for small areas, particularly architectural features. Expensive and requires specialist skills.

How Flat Roofing Works
Understanding basic flat roof construction helps you appreciate what you’re investing in.
The Structure
Joists: Timber or steel beams providing structural support and creating the roof shape.
Deck: Boards (typically OSB or plywood) fixed to joists, creating the surface the waterproof covering attaches to.
Insulation: Rigid foam boards (usually PIR or phenolic) providing thermal performance. Positioned above the deck in modern “warm roof” construction.
Membrane: The waterproof covering—EPDM, felt, GRP, or other material.
Edge details: Trims, drip edges, and termination profiles around the perimeter.
Upstands: Where the roof meets walls, the covering turns up the wall and is sealed.
Falls and Drainage
Despite being called “flat,” these roofs actually incorporate slight slopes (falls) directing water toward drainage points. Minimum falls of 1:40 to 1:80 are standard.
Drainage options:
- External gutters at roof edges
- Internal outlets connecting to downpipes
- Combination systems
Effective drainage prevents ponding, which can stress materials and create leak risks.
Penetrations
Pipes, vents, skylights, and other features passing through the roof require careful sealing. Purpose-made collars, formed details, and compatible sealants create watertight junctions.
The Installation Process
Understanding installation helps you assess quotes and recognise quality work.
Professional Installation Steps
1. Survey and specification: Detailed measurement, condition assessment, and material specification.
2. Preparation: Access setup, protection of surrounding areas, material staging.
3. Removal (for replacements): Existing covering stripped back to the deck.
4. Deck inspection and repair: Thorough checking of underlying boards, replacement of any damaged sections.
5. Insulation installation: Rigid boards laid, staggered, and secured.
6. Membrane application: EPDM positioned, adhesive applied to both surfaces, membrane bonded and rolled for full contact.
7. Edge detailing: Drip edges and trims fitted, membrane dressed over and sealed.
8. Upstands: Membrane turned up walls, secured, and top edge sealed.
9. Penetration sealing: All pipes, vents, and features properly sealed.
10. Inspection and handover: Quality check, documentation, and maintenance guidance.
Installation Timeframes
| Project Type | Typical Duration |
|---|---|
| Bay window or small porch | Half day |
| Large porch | Half to one day |
| Single garage | One day |
| Double garage | 1–2 days |
| Small extension | 1–2 days |
| Large extension | 2–3 days |
Add time if significant deck repair is needed.
Weather Requirements
EPDM installation requires:
- Dry conditions (no rain during adhesive work)
- Temperature above 5°C
- Manageable wind levels
Quality installers reschedule rather than work in unsuitable conditions.
Flat Roofing Costs for Residential Properties
Understanding realistic costs helps with budgeting and quote evaluation.
Cost by Project Type
| Application | Size Range | Typical Cost (EPDM) |
|---|---|---|
| Bay window roof | 2–4m² | £300–£600 |
| Small porch | 2–5m² | £350–£600 |
| Large porch | 5–10m² | £500–£950 |
| Single garage | 15–20m² | £750–£1,400 |
| Double garage | 30–40m² | £1,200–£2,200 |
| Small extension | 10–20m² | £800–£1,600 |
| Medium extension | 20–35m² | £1,400–£2,800 |
| Large extension | 35–50m² | £2,200–£3,800 |
| Garden room | 15–25m² | £1,000–£2,000 |
What’s Included
Quality quotes should include:
- EPDM membrane
- Appropriate insulation
- All edge trims and details
- Penetration sealing
- Professional installation
- Waste removal
- Warranty documentation
Factors Affecting Cost
Roof size: Larger roofs cost more but benefit from better per-square-metre rates.
Complexity: Simple rectangles cost less than complex shapes with multiple sections.
Penetrations: Each skylight or penetration adds detailing time and cost.
Deck condition: Replacement of damaged boards adds to the total.
Access: Difficult access increases labour time.
Insulation specification: Enhanced thermal performance adds material cost.
Location: South Wales pricing is generally competitive compared to South East England. Whether you’re in Cardiff, Swansea, Merthyr Tydfil, Aberdare, or elsewhere, local market rates apply.
Cost Comparison: EPDM vs Felt
Over 30 years for a typical garage roof:
EPDM: £1,100 initial + minimal repairs = approximately £1,200 total Felt: £500 initial + £300 repairs + £550 replacement at year 12 + £250 repairs + £600 replacement at year 24 = approximately £2,200 total
Quality EPDM costs less over time despite higher upfront investment.
Building Regulations and Compliance
Understanding regulatory requirements prevents problems.
When Building Regulations Apply
Regulations typically apply to:
- New roofs on extensions and additions
- Significant re-roofing projects
- Any work affecting thermal performance
- Structural changes
Simple like-for-like repairs usually don’t require building regulations approval.
Key Requirements
Thermal performance: Roofs must achieve specified U-values, typically requiring 100–150mm insulation depending on type.
Structural adequacy: The roof must support expected loads safely.
Weather resistance: Appropriate materials properly installed.
Fire safety: Materials meeting relevant fire ratings.
Drainage: Adequate provision preventing problems for your and neighbouring properties.

Flat Roofing Performance in South Wales
Our regional climate affects flat roof performance and material choice.
Weather Challenges
Rainfall: South Wales receives 1,200mm+ annually in many areas, with the valleys often seeing more. Persistent wet conditions test waterproofing thoroughly.
Temperature variation: Valley properties experience colder winters than coastal areas. Temperature cycling stresses roofing materials.
Wind exposure: Coastal and hilltop properties face significant wind loading. Exposed sites need robust edge details.
UV exposure: Even Welsh sunshine causes material degradation over time.
How Materials Perform
EPDM: Handles all South Wales conditions excellently. Doesn’t degrade in persistent wet, remains flexible through temperature extremes, resists UV without additional protection.
Felt: Struggles with persistent moisture. Our wet climate tends to shorten felt lifespan compared to drier regions.
GRP: Performs well when intact, but cracking risk exists if buildings move in variable temperature conditions.

Maintaining Residential Flat Roofs
Proper maintenance extends life and catches problems early.
Routine Maintenance
Twice yearly (spring and autumn):
- Clear debris (leaves, twigs, accumulated material)
- Check and clear drainage outlets
- Visual inspection of surface, edges, and penetrations
- Clear connected gutters
After severe weather:
- Check for obvious damage
- Confirm drainage is functioning
- Look for anything displaced
What to Watch For
Address promptly:
- Any visible damage
- Edges lifting or separating
- New stains on ceiling below
- Water not draining properly
Arrange professional inspection:
- If problems recur
- Every 5–10 years for thorough assessment
- Before warranty expires
Maintenance by Material Type
EPDM: Minimal maintenance required. Debris clearance and visual checks suffice.
Felt: Needs more attention as it ages. May require periodic coating with solar reflective paint.
GRP: Regular inspection for cracks, especially if building has moved. Topcoat may need refreshing.
Protecting Your Investment
Do:
- Keep debris clear
- Maintain drainage
- Address damage promptly
- Avoid unnecessary foot traffic
Don’t:
- Store items on the roof
- Use incompatible products for repairs
- Ignore developing problems
- Allow vegetation to establish
Common Flat Roof Problems and Solutions
Understanding problems helps with early identification.
Leaks
Symptoms: Water stains, damp patches, actual dripping.
Causes: Failed seals at penetrations, lifted edges, punctures, material failure.
Solution: Professional diagnosis identifies source. Repair if localised; replacement if widespread.
Ponding Water
Symptoms: Water remaining 48+ hours after rain.
Causes: Insufficient falls, blocked drainage, structural settling.
Solution: Clear blockages first. If ponding persists, assess whether drainage improvements or additional falls are needed.
Blistering
Symptoms: Raised bubbles on roof surface.
Causes: Trapped moisture, adhesive failure.
Solution: Small blisters may be monitored. Large or numerous blisters require professional attention.
Edge Failures
Symptoms: Water tracking down walls, visible gaps at edges.
Causes: Thermal movement, wind uplift, age deterioration.
Solution: Re-seal if localised. Consider replacement if edges are failing generally.
Storm Damage
Symptoms: Lifted sections, punctures from debris, displaced materials.
Causes: Severe weather events.
Solution: Document for insurance. Professional repair or replacement depending on extent.

Frequently Asked Questions
How long does a flat roof last?
EPDM rubber roofing lasts 30–50 years. Fibreglass typically achieves 20–25 years. Felt roofs last 10–15 years. Quality installation significantly affects actual lifespan.
Are flat roofs problematic?
Historically, flat roofs had reputation issues due to poor felt installations. Modern EPDM flat roofing is highly reliable. Problems typically stem from poor installation or neglected maintenance, not inherent material issues.
Can flat roofs handle heavy rain?
Yes. Quality flat roofing handles any UK rainfall conditions. EPDM is completely waterproof and doesn’t degrade in wet conditions. Proper falls and drainage ensure water clears efficiently.
Do flat roofs need maintenance?
Minimal maintenance is required—primarily debris clearance and periodic inspection. This takes perhaps an hour per year for most residential flat roofs.
Can I walk on a flat roof?
Occasionally for maintenance access, yes. Regular foot traffic may require walkway protection. Avoid walking on flat roofs unnecessarily.
Is planning permission needed for flat roof work?
Usually no for repair or replacement. New flat roofs on extensions may fall under permitted development but depend on specific circumstances. Check with your local planning authority if unsure.
Can flat roofs be insulated?
Yes, and they should be. Modern flat roof construction includes insulation meeting building regulations. Upgrading insulation during re-roofing improves energy efficiency.
What’s better: flat or pitched roof for an extension?
Flat roofs are typically more practical for single-storey extensions—lower height, easier integration, often avoiding planning requirements. Either can work depending on design preferences and site constraints.
